Taiwan-based ODM Compal Electronics on October 28 announced it will acquire Toshiba Television Central Europe (TTCE), Toshiba's LCD TV assembly factory in Wroclaw, Poland, for US$25 million, with the sales transaction to be finished by the end of the first quarter of 2014.
  Compal will set up a wholly own Europe-based subsidiary, tentatively named Compal Europe Holding, and then have the subsidiary acquire a 100% stake in TTCE, Compal indicated. With the factory having a monthly production capacity of one million LCD TVs, the acquisition can enhance Compal's existing cooperation with Toshiba and help it compete for more ODM orders from other LCD TV vendors, the company pointed out. Following the acquisition, Toshiba will continue procurement of LCD TVs to be made at the factory, Compal said.
  Toshiba is currently Compal's largest ODM client for LCD TVs, accounting for about 50% of Compal's ODM production, according to players in the Taiwan-based supply chain. Due to strong competition from South Korea- and China-based vendors, Toshiba has downwardly adjusted its 2013 target shipments from 10 million LCD TVs originally to 8-9 million units, the sources indicated. In addition to Compal, Toshiba's LCD TV ODMs include Taiwan-based Pegatron and Turkey-based Vestel, the sources noted. In order to minimize LCD TV production costs, Toshiba plans to increase ODM orders but reduce the number of ODMs and therefore Compal's acquisition of the factory is possibly motivated by securing steady ODM orders from Toshiba, the sources pointed out.
  Compal shipped 2.4 million LCD TVs to ODM clients during the first three quarters and is expected to ship 3.0-4.0 million units in 2013, the sources noted.
